NRT secures quarterfinal berth in Birat Gold Cup, defeats Tribhuvan Army Club

MORANG: The New Road Team (NRT) has advanced to the quarterfinals of the Birat Gold Cup, currently underway in Morang. In a thrilling match held at the Shahid Stadium in Biratnagar last night, NRT secured a convincing 2-0 victory over Tribhuvan Army Club.

The NRT players Richard and Afiz Olabal showcased outstanding performances, each scoring a goal to secure the win for their team.

Following their triumph, NRT is set to face Sikkim Degan of India in the second quarterfinal match scheduled for Sunday. Afiz of NRT was honored as the 'Player of the Match', earning a cash prize of Rs 11,000.

Meanwhile, the first quarterfinal match of the tournament is set to take place tonight between Shangri-La Morang Football Club and Bhutan's RTC FC Club.

The Birat Gold Cup has attracted participation from Nepal's A Division clubs as well as teams from India and Bhutan.

The tournament offers a lucrative prize pool, with the winner set to receive Rs 1.1 million and the runner-up to be awarded Rs 550,000.
